Field hockey

Domestic league

Duncan currently competes in the Irish Hockey League, where he represents Monkstown. [4] [1]

Under–21

He made his debut for the Irish U–21 team in 2014 at the EuroHockey Junior Championship II in Lousada. [6]

Senior national team

Duncan made his senior international debut in 2014. He appeared in a test series against England in Reading. [6]

Since his debut, Duncan has been present at numerous international events. He has medalled once with the national team, taking home gold at the 2023 edition of the EuroHockey Championship II. [7]

He competed at the 2024 FIH Olympic Qualifiers in Valencia. [6] [8] [9]
